Doug ...    Nice find !     The inside of the 202 is one of the cleanest I've seen.       The set was designed for local battery magneto service.     The N515H subscriber set is an anti-sidetone set, and was intended for single party service, or a lightly loaded party line.     If you intend on wiring it for common battery, I'd suggest swapping out the 104-A induction coil for a 101-A.     See attached pages from the N.E. T-8 (1954) Telephone Catalog.
